The Associate Director- QA Compliance, will report to the Director of Supplier Management and Auditing. This key position will conduct GMP audits of Gilead’s global suppliers with a primary focus on external biologics manufacturing focusing on aseptic techniques and sterile processes, contract packaging and contract testing labs. Primarily conduct global vendor audits for contract manufacturing of Gilead Biologics
Support and/or conduct audits of providers of raw materials, product contact consumables, contract manufacturing or testing, software, warehouse / distribution in support of Gilead’s clinical and commercial oral and parenteral dosage formulations and associated medical devices as assigned.
Manage all aspects of the audit lifecycle including scheduling, planning, issuing agendas, executing, issuing reports, evaluating responses, requesting clarification, issuing CA/PA, and closing.
Ensure CA/PA to address compliance concerns identified during audits are commensurate with current biologics industry practices and benchmarks
Ensure that the audit agenda is risk-based and has the appropriate internal and/or external subject matter experts as part of the audit team.
Participate in the development, implementation, and maintenance of procedures and templates to assist in the evaluation of and in improvement of the auditing process. 
Identify compliance risks and escalate issues to appropriate levels of management for resolution. 
Promote, awareness across the biologics commercial and clinical manufacturing platform(s) of current regulatory agency requirements and trends and develop and report on the trends identified to better focus the scope of audits.
Drive consistency with audit report observation writing, classification, status, and overall risk
Support external relationship management as auditor and/or Supplier management capacity
Travel is required up to 50%
Supports Compliance management in maintaining the company’s Compliance program.
May manage the day-to-day activities of one or more individual contributors, including task assignment and prioritization, monitoring task performance, and conducting performance reviews.
Ensures awareness of biologics compliance requirements across impacted functional areas
Establishes excellent working relationships with compliance/quality groups.
Responsible for maintaining current knowledge of applicable compliance requirements through attendance at industry and regulatory agency sponsored meetings and seminars and individual self-study including periodic review of all relevant regulations, guidance documents, and requirements.
Provide guidance to assigned departments and management when specific compliance issues arise. 
Assists in evaluation and implementation of standard operating procedures and systems needed to comply with requirements. 
Leads various types of audits or projects or supervises contractors. Audits may include internal systems audits, external vendor audits, or document reviews.
Assists in regulatory agency inspections. Assists in coordination of responses to any regulatory agency findings.
